Extra-long hair (typically 60cm/24 inches and beyond) faces unique challenges that shorter hair simply doesn't encounter:
- Older cuticle structure: The ends of extra-long hair can be 5-7 years old, making them significantly more weathered than roots.
- Cumulative damage: Years of heat styling, chemical treatments, UV exposure, and mechanical friction compound at the distal ends.
- Reduced natural sebum distribution: Scalp-produced oils struggle to travel the full length of extra-long strands, leaving ends chronically under-nourished.
- Increased mechanical stress: Brushing, sleeping, and styling create exponentially more friction on longer strands.
The result? Split ends aren't just cosmetic—they're a structural failure of the hair shaft that, if left unchecked, travels upward and causes breakage.
A nourishing hair oil is a leave-in or pre-wash treatment formulated with lipid-rich botanical oils (argan, jojoba, coconut, marula, etc.) designed to:
- Seal the cuticle and reduce moisture loss
- Add instant shine and smoothness
- Provide a protective barrier against heat and environmental stressors
- Temporarily disguise frayed ends by binding them together

A repairing hair mask is a rinse-out intensive treatment (used 1-2 times weekly) that delivers:
- Deep hydration via humectants (hyaluronic acid, glycerin, panthenol)
- Protein reinforcement (keratin, hydrolyzed wheat protein, amino acids) to rebuild weakened bonds
- Lipid replenishment to restore the hair's natural barrier
- Bond-repair technology (in advanced formulas) to reconstruct disulfide bridges damaged by bleaching or heat

| Factor | Nourishing Hair Oil | Repairing Hair Mask |
|---|---|---|
| Primary Function | Surface sealing, shine, daily protection | Deep repair, bond rebuilding, intensive hydration |
| Best For | Daily maintenance, heat protection, instant smoothing | Weekly intensive repair, chemically damaged hair |
| Application Frequency | Daily or every wash | 1-2 times per week |
| Contact Time | Leave-in (no rinse) or 15-30 min pre-wash | 10-20 minutes rinse-out |
| Key Ingredients | Argan oil, jojoba, squalane, vitamin E | Keratin, amino acids, hyaluronic acid, ceramides |
| Split-End Impact | Temporarily seals and prevents further splitting | Rebuilds internal structure, reduces existing damage |
| Ideal Hair Type | All types, especially fine to medium | Thick, coarse, bleached, or severely damaged hair |
Expert verdict from iHot Cosmetics: For preventing split ends on extra-long hair, the optimal approach is both—a weekly repairing mask to rebuild structure, plus daily oil application to seal and protect ends.

Based on client feedback and in-house testing, we recommend this protocol for extra-long hair:
1. Weekly Deep Repair (Mask): Use a protein-rich, bond-repair mask focused on mid-lengths and ends. Leave on for 15-20 minutes with heat (warm towel or steamer) to enhance penetration.
2. Daily Sealing (Oil): Apply 2-3 drops of lightweight oil blend to damp or dry ends after every wash, and as needed between washes.
3. Heat & Mechanical Protection: Always apply a heat protectant before styling, and use silk pillowcases + microfiber towels to reduce friction.

When developing your hair care line with iHot Cosmetics, here are the must-have ingredients we recommend for split-end prevention:
- Argan Oil: Rich in vitamin E and fatty acids; penetrates without greasiness.
- Jojoba Oil: Mimics natural sebum; ideal for scalp-to-end balance.
- Squalane: Ultra-lightweight; enhances shine without buildup.
- Vitamin E (Tocopherol): Antioxidant protection against UV and pollution.
- Camellia Seed Oil: Traditional Asian beauty secret; exceptional for extra-long hair smoothness.
- Hydrolyzed Keratin: Rebuilds protein structure; reduces breakage by up to 50%. [proteinjug]
- Panthenol (Pro-Vitamin B5): Deep hydration; improves elasticity.
- Hyaluronic Acid: Binds moisture to hair shaft; prevents dryness-induced splitting.
- Ceramides: Restore lipid barrier; seal cuticle layers.
- Bond-Repair Complexes (e.g., bis-aminopropyl diglycol dimaleate): Reconstruct disulfide bonds in bleached hair.
Pro tip: Avoid heavy silicones (dimethicone in high concentrations) in oils for extra-long hair—they create buildup that weighs hair down and blocks subsequent treatments from penetrating.
